A bar magnet A of magnetic moment `M_(A)` is found to oscillate at a frequency twice that of magnet B of magnetic moment `M_(B)` when placed in a vibration magnetometer. `M_(A) and M_(B)` are related as

A

`M_(A)=2M_(B)`

B

`M_(A)=8M_(B)`

C

`M_(A)=4M_(B)`

D

`M_(A)=(1)/(8)M_(B)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

`(T_(A))/(T_(B))=sqrt((M_(B))/(M_(A)))rArr ("Freq. of B")/("Freq. of A")=(1)/(2), :. M_(A)=4M_(B)`
